The cost to install a commercial garage door varies widely, typically ranging from $2,000 to $10,000 or more. The final price depends on several key factors: the door's size, material (steel, aluminum, glass), insulation level, and operational mechanism (sectional, roll-up, high-speed). Additional costs include the commercial-grade opener system, necessary electrical work, and any custom features like windows or security enhancements. Professional installation is crucial for safety, durability, and warranty compliance. The typical cost to install a new garage door, including the door itself and professional installation, generally ranges from $750 to $1,500 for a standard single door. For a double-car garage door, the range is typically $1,200 to $2,500. The final price depends heavily on the material (steel, wood, aluminum), insulation level, design complexity, and any additional features like windows or smart openers. Professional installation is crucial for safety and proper operation, as it ensures correct spring tension and alignment. The labor cost to install a commercial door varies significantly based on the door type, size, and project complexity. On average, you can expect labor to range from $500 to $2,000 or more per door. Factors influencing this include the door's material (steel, aluminum, glass), its operational mechanism (swing, sliding, overhead), and necessary modifications to the existing structure. Electrical work for automated systems adds considerable cost. Installation of a standard commercial steel door by a professional typically involves 4-8 hours of labor. Always obtain multiple detailed quotes from licensed and insured contractors, as proper installation is critical for security, energy efficiency, and compliance with building codes.

The average cost for installing a new steel entry door typically ranges from $500 to $1,500, with a national average around $1,000. This price includes both the door unit and professional installation. Basic, pre-hung steel doors start at the lower end, while higher-end models with decorative glass, upgraded hardware, or special finishes can reach the upper range. Factors influencing cost include the door's size, style, insulation value, and any structural modifications needed to the existing frame. Professional installation is crucial for ensuring proper fit, security, and energy efficiency. The cost of an industrial garage door installation varies significantly based on several key factors. For a standard new installation, you can expect a range from approximately $2,000 to over $10,000. The primary cost drivers include the door's material (steel, aluminum, fiberglass), size (common commercial sizes are much larger than residential), insulation rating, and the type of operating mechanism (manual chain hoist vs. motorized operator). Additional expenses arise from necessary structural reinforcements, customizations like windows or high-speed operation, and local labor rates. Industrial garage door installation requires careful planning and adherence to safety standards. Begin by reviewing the manufacturer's specific manual for your door model, as specifications vary. Ensure the opening is square, level, and structurally sound. Installation typically involves assembling the door sections, installing tracks and hardware, and mounting the spring system—which is extremely dangerous and should only be handled by trained professionals due to high tension. Properly secure all components and test the door's balance and safety features, like auto-reverse mechanisms. Given the complexity and risk, hiring a certified installer is strongly recommended to ensure correct operation and warranty compliance.
